Habitat for Humanity is a non-profit organization dedicated to building homes for those in the community who need it most. Everyone in the Pine Belt having a decent place to live.
 
Habitats mission is to empower families with a life-changing opportunity to own a decent house they can call home.  Every family deserves to own a home that is both clean and affordable, regardless of their race, ethnicity, gender or religion. Pine Belt Habitat's greatest mission is to provide families with sustainable housing, while ensuring they reach homeownership status.
 
Habitat for Humanity today operates around the globe and has helped build, renovate and repair more than 600,000 decent, affordable houses sheltering more than 3 million people worldwide.
Habitat welcomes volunteers and supporters from all backgrounds and also serves people in need of decent housing regardless of race or religion. As a matter of policy, Habitat for Humanity International and its affiliated organizations do not proselytize. This means that Habitat will not offer assistance on the expressed or implied condition that people must either adhere to or convert to a particular faith or listen and respond to messaging designed to induce conversion to a particular faith.
